    2023-2024 Band Book

    The PNHS Band Boosters are pleased to announce a new offering for this year. Our dedicated photo team has curated a collection of stunning photos featuring our students. We are in the process of creating an 8.5’ x 11’ soft bound photo book, containing 20-25 pages of vibrant, full-color images, to complement the yearbook. This exclusive item is available for pre-order only at a cost of $30.
